Display rules are cultural norms that relate to the __________ component of emotion.

Social Studies
1 answer:
kap26 [50]1 year ago
6 0

Display rules are cultural norms that relate to the <u>behavioral</u> component of emotion.

HELP PLS.one paragraph explaining how a command economy works.
djverab [1.8K]

Answer:

A Command Economy is a system where the government , rather than the free market , determines what goods should be produced , how much should be produced , and the price at which the goods are offered for sale . It also determines investments and incomes . The Command Economy is a key feature of any communist society .
